“bolter”这个词在英语中有多种含义。第一个解释为一匹逃跑的马。一个突然逃离问题/关系的人。对回避性依恋人格的最好描述。她很迷人,但却没人能真正留住她。那些形形色色的憎恶、甜爱和**,从她身上通过,她一点也不感到疼痛。那些无形的爱像是束缚,更像是童年困住她的坚冰。只有在她逃跑的瞬间,她才又一次感觉自己得救。她终于抓住了岸边的石头,那种劫后余生的滋味叫自由。Aaron的吉他编曲不要太封神。
